Small Group 3.5 Hour Skaftafell Ice Cave and Glacier Walk

Summary

You will meet your guide at our sales lodge in Skaftafell national park. From there a minibus will take you to the glacier, an outlet glacier of Vatnajökull glacier. You will strap on your crampons and step on to the ice. Your guide will lead you through the ice cap and to a naturally formed ice cave.

About operator:

Icelandic Mountain Guides is Iceland's premier adventure tour operator. The company was established in 1994 by four young outdoor enthusiasts with a passion for nature, travel and environmental advocacy. These pioneers aimed to introduce the wonders of Icelandic nature to travelers from all over the world. We started by offering Glacier Walks in Skaftafell and later on Solheimajokull glacier. Hiking, backpacking and other adventures and expeditions in Iceland and Greenland soon followed. Today, Icelandic Mountain Guides offers adventure tours ranging from short day tours to longer multi-day expeditions in the great outdoors in both summer and winter.
